Despite soaring gold prices, reaching $2,400 per ounce this year, devotees continue to generously donate gold to the Tirumala Tirupati Devasthanams (TTD), the world's richest Hindu temple trust. In 2023, TTD recorded a deposit of 1,031 kg of gold valued at Rs 773 crore. The trust holds a total of 11,329 kg of gold, worth Rs 8,496 crore, in nationalised banks under the gold monetisation scheme. The trend of increasing gold donations persists even as the global economy faces uncertainty, with TTD receiving an average of one tonne of gold annually over the past four years. Alongside gold, TTD also receives substantial cash offerings, with an average monthly donation exceeding Rs 100 crore. The temple's hundi collection averages Rs 1,600 crore yearly. TTD's assets include Rs 19,000 crore in fixed deposits, nearly 14 tonnes of gold, and 85,000 acres of property, reinforcing its status as India's wealthiest temple trust.
